Humiera Bargzie Obituary, Death – The family of Cambridge Elementary teacher Humiera Bargzie, who died away recently, has the Mt. Diablo Unified School District’s deepest condolences. Humiera Bargzie had been with the district for many years.
“It is with a heavy heart that I communicate to you that Mrs. Bargzie passed away on Saturday morning due to complications with her health,” Cambridge Elementary Principal Lourdes Beleche said in a message to school families on December 28th.

We shall miss her. We are keeping her and her loved ones in our thoughts and prayers at this time.”
“She was an inspiring, dedicated teacher and advocate for her children and community,” said District Bilingual Elementary coach Monica Navarro-Kirby in a tweet that included a photo of a school monument set up in Mrs. Bargzie’s honor.
